3-(3-Hydroxy-4-methoxyphenyl)-6-methoxy-7-[3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xychromen-4-one
Internal ID | dea6faf7-56f3-46cf-aae6-680d7c67f2ee |
Taxonomy | Phenylpropanoids and polyketides > Isoflavonoids > Isoflavonoid O-glycosides |
IUPAC Name | 3-(3-hydroxy-4-methoxyphenyl)-6-methoxy-7-[3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xychromen-4-one |
SMILES (Canonical) | COC1=C(C=C(C=C1)C2=COC3=CC(=C(C=C3C2=O)OC)OC4C(C(C(C(O4)CO)O)O)O)O |
SMILES (Isomeric) | COC1=C(C=C(C=C1)C2=COC3=CC(=C(C=C3C2=O)OC)OC4C(C(C(C(O4)CO)O)O)O)O |
InChI | InChI=1S/C23H24O11/c1-30-14-4-3-10(5-13(14)25)12-9-32-15-7-17(16(31-2)6-11(15)19(12)26)33-23-22(29)21(28)20(27)18(8-24)34-23/h3-7,9,18,20-25,27-29H,8H2,1-2H3 |
InChI Key | MSAVZPBSIHMNFX-UHFFFAOYSA-N |
Popularity | 0 references in papers |
Molecular Formula | C23H24O11 |
Molecular Weight | 476.40 g/mol |
Exact Mass | 476.13186158 g/mol |
Topological Polar Surface Area (TPSA) | 164.00 Ų |
XlogP | 0.60 |
